Job Description

JOB GOAL:

To advance the colleges mission vision principles values and strategic initiatives through continuous improvement decisions.

GENERAL JOB SUMMARY:

Under moderate to limited supervision provides department support manages department processes and ensures smooth running of the office.

The typical work schedule will be Monday through Friday from 8 am to 5 pm.

D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Answer and/or redirect basic inquiries from internal and external customers either via phone calls email or in person.
  • Coordinate materials for mailings maintain department records generate reports schedule and coordinate meetings and events and maintain computer databases.
  • Assist with large and smallscale department events including logistics and communication.
  • Prepare and maintain correspondence lists and other documents.
  • Perform various office clerical duties including filing typing scanning maintaining copiers and other equipment ordering supplies sorting/distributing mail etc.
  • Assist with management of department budget.
  • Provide administrative support to department Dean.
  • Provide limited support to instructional designers and faculty development staff in the department including project management.
  • Assist with various department activities and events.
  • Perform other related work duties as assigned.

PHYSICAL ACTIVITIES WITH/WITHOUT REASONABLE ACCOMMODATION:

Position involves working in an office setting. Occasional 1033 standing pushing pulling and grasping. Frequent 3466 reaching and viewing a computer and other types of close visual work. Constant 67100 sitting walking repetitive motion talking and hearing.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• High school diploma or equivalency plus two years related experience; or an Associates degree in a related field.
  • Possess a good working knowledge of personal computers and Microsoft Office products with an emphasis on Word and Excel.
  • Knowledge of standard office equipment.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S LICENSES CERTIFICATIONS OR REGISTRATIONS:

  • Associates degree in a related field.
  • Experience in an educational setting.
  • Advanced educational technologies knowledge and experience.

WHY KIRKWOOD:
Kirkwood Community College prides itself on fostering a diverse workforce and values unique perspectives throughout its campus community. The college is a convenient innovative visionary educational leader striving to remain affordable and accessible. With more than 140 majors and programs Kirkwood boasts 16000 annual collegecredit students while maintaining one of the lowest tuitions in the state. All degreeseeking students are eligible for federal financial aid and the college offers more than $3 million in scholarships each year to students from all walks of life.
